What This Detects
KillSec's encryptor is unsophisticated compared to top-tier RaaS families (no BYOVD/EDR-kill chain on file) – hunting relies on the generic but reliable signal of rapid mass file renaming plus ransom-note creation across many folders on one host.
Query
let massRename = DeviceFileEvents
| where Timestamp > ago(1d)
| where ActionType == "FileRenamed"
| summarize RenameCount = count(), Folders = dcount(FolderPath) by DeviceName, InitiatingProcessAccountName, bin(Timestamp, 10m)
| where RenameCount > 200 and Folders > 5;
let ransomNote = DeviceFileEvents
| where Timestamp > ago(1d)
| where FileName has_any ("README","DECRYPT","How_to_restore","RECOVER")
| project DeviceName, NoteTime = Timestamp, FileName;
massRename
| join kind=inner ransomNote on DeviceName
| project DeviceName, InitiatingProcessAccountName, RenameCount, Folders, NoteTime, FileName
